Default Short shocks

I have 10.5 " shocks on both my Sporty and my SG so my feet are flat footed. I'm 5'2" and love the look also. However I would love to have a more comfortable ride . Now I don't believe it's possible to have short shocks and a comfortable ride. With new technology I was wondering if any manufacturer has changed that. I could go no bigger than 11" shocks but I don't think 1/2 " is going to make any difference.
